All businesses in Brechin, ON

3 D Automation

RR 1, Brechin ON
(705) 484-5301
computer computer consultant

Above Board Covers

2188 Concession Rd 3, Brechin ON
(705) 484-9935
boats upholstering tauds

Ann's Country Clean

2201 Highway 12, Brechin ON
(705) 279-0548
Categories:

Arctic Air Refrigeration

2397 Lakeshore Dr, Brechin ON
(705) 484-5054
refrigeration

A To Z Construction & Siding

RR 3, Brechin ON
(705) 484-0954
Categories:
decks renovations
Avon Online

Avon Online

2726 Stephen Drive, Brechin ON
(705) 426-4020
Avon ONline at http://www.facebook.com/?ref=home#!/pages/Avon-Online/134379816626266 on Facebook offers Clearance, Daily Deals, Ebrochure links, and exclusive discounts to our fans! Like us today!...

Black's Auto Repair

1271 Concession Rd 6, Brechin ON
(705) 484-1585
automobile body repairing body painting

Brand C P Dr

2263 Hwy 12 (2), Brechin ON
(705) 484-5352
doctor

Brechin Auto Body Collision Specialists

2571 Harrigan Dr, Brechin ON
(705) 484-5788
Categories:
automobile garage bodywork

Brechin Dental

3259 Ramara Road 47, Brechin ON
(705) 484-5319
Categories:

Brechin Feed & Farm Supplies

Hwy 12, Brechin ON
(705) 484-5941
farm supplies

Brechin Foodland

Hwy 12, Brechin ON
(705) 484-0032
Categories:
grocers grocerie store grocery store

Brechin Mara Legion

2146 Concession Road 4, Brechin ON
(705) 484-5393
Categories:
association

Brechin Tim Br Mart

2218 Hwy 12, Brechin ON
(705) 484-5357
insulation